通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

软件研发学不会怎么办

软件研发学不会怎么办

如果你发现自己在软件研发的学习过程中遇到困难,无法掌握相关技能,你应该首先理解这是一个正常的过程,不要过于焦虑或自我怀疑。其次,你应该找出学习的难点,加强针对性的学习和实践。再者,寻求他人的帮助,如同班同学、老师、或者在线社区的专业人士,他们可能会给你提供不同的视角和解决问题的思路。最后,积极调整学习态度和方法,如将大的学习任务分解为小任务,每天专注于一个小任务的学习和实践,避免一次性吸收过多信息导致的学习压力。 接下来,我会详细解释以上各点,以帮助你克服学习软件研发的难点。

一、理解学习难题是正常的过程

对于任何人来说,学习新的技能或知识都是一个挑战。特别是对于软件研发这样复杂且需要不断更新的领域,面对学习难题更是常态。你可能会发现自己无法理解某些概念,或者无法将学过的知识应用到实际问题中。这些都是正常的学习困难,并不意味着你无法掌握软件研发。相反,通过克服这些困难,你会更深入地理解软件研发,并且在解决问题的过程中提升自己的能力。

二、找出学习的难点,加强针对性的学习和实践

找出你在软件研发学习中的难点,是解决问题的第一步。你可以尝试回顾你的学习过程,找出那些让你感到困惑或挫败的部分。这些难点可能涉及到某个具体的编程语言,某个开发工具,或者是某个软件研发的理论概念。找出这些难点后,你就可以有针对性地进行学习和实践。例如,如果你发现自己无法理解某个编程语言的语法,你可以找一些该语言的教程和示例,通过反复的学习和练习来掌握。

三、寻求他人的帮助,获取不同的学习视角和思路

在学习软件研发的过程中,寻求他人的帮助是非常有用的。你可以向你的同学、老师或者在线社区的专业人士寻求帮助。他们可能会从不同的视角来解释你的学习难点,或者给你提供解决问题的新思路。此外,他们也可能会分享他们在学习和实践软件研发过程中的经验,这些经验可能会对你有很大的帮助。

四、调整学习态度和方法,分解学习任务

调整学习态度和方法,也是解决软件研发学习难题的重要方式。首先,你需要保持积极的学习态度,相信自己有能力克服当前的困难。其次,你需要调整学习方法,避免一次性吸收过多的信息。你可以尝试将大的学习任务分解为小任务,每天专注于一个小任务的学习和实践。这样,你可以更有效地掌握学习内容,也可以减少学习压力。

五、结论

总的来说,学习软件研发并不是一件容易的事,但只要你能够保持积极的态度,找出你的学习难点,寻求他人的帮助,并调整你的学习方法,你一定能够克服当前的困难,成功掌握软件研发。

相关问答FAQs:

1. 我不具备编程背景,是否还能学会软件研发?

当然可以!尽管没有编程背景可能会让学习过程稍微困难一些,但并不意味着你不能学会软件研发。有很多在线课程和教程可供选择,它们专门设计用于初学者。同时,你还可以考虑参加编程培训班或寻求导师的帮助。重要的是保持积极态度和耐心,并充分利用各种学习资源。

2. 软件研发需要学习哪些编程语言?

软件研发涉及多种编程语言,具体要学习哪些语言取决于你的兴趣和目标。常见的编程语言包括Java、Python、C++、JavaScript等。Java适用于开发企业级应用程序,Python广泛用于数据分析和人工智能领域,C++常用于系统级开发,而JavaScript则是前端开发的主要语言。选择一种你感兴趣的语言,然后深入学习它,逐渐扩展你的技能。

3. 学习软件研发需要多长时间?

学习软件研发的时间因人而异,取决于你的学习速度、投入的时间和学习资源的质量。对于初学者来说,掌握基本的编程概念和语法可能需要几个月的时间。然而,要成为一名优秀的软件研发人员,需要不断学习和实践。要做到这一点,可能需要几年的时间。重要的是保持学习的动力和持之以恒的精神,不断提升自己的技能水平。

相关文章